ABSTRACT:
A floor scrubber is disclosed including a frame including a drive wheel, rear wheels, brushes, vacuum squeegee system, batteries, solution tanks, and an operator seat. The rear wheels are rotatably mounted on the opposite ends of a steel rod. Arms are attached rigidly to the axle and each include a cylindrical pivot in which an elastomer bushing is press fit. Pivot pins extend through first and second pairs of first and second plates and the elastomer bushing for pivotably mounting the arms to the frame while isolating any transmitted vibrations. Elastomeric isolator mounts are provided each including a frusto-conical shaped body and each having a nut embedded in the lower end for threadable receipt of a bolt passing through an attachment plate attached to the axle. The upper ends of the elastomeric isolator mounts each include a plate secured thereto and secured to the frame.
